JCUSER-WVMdslBw
JCUSER-WVMdslBw2025-05-01 01:20

Tendermint hangi uzlaşma algoritmasını kullanır?

Tendermint Hangi Konsensüs Algoritmasını Kullanıyor?

Tendermint, blokzincir uygulamalarının geliştirilmesini kolaylaştırmak amacıyla tasarlanmış önde gelen açık kaynaklı bir çerçevedir. Gücünün temelinde, merkeziyetsiz bir ağdaki tüm düğümlerin blokzincirin mevcut durumu üzerinde anlaşmasını sağlayan konsensüs algoritması yatmaktadır. Bu algoritmanın anlaşılması, Tendermint’in güvenlik, verimlilik ve ölçeklenebilirliği nasıl koruduğunu kavramak isteyen geliştiriciler, yatırımcılar ve meraklılar için çok önemlidir.

Tendermint'in Genel Bakışı ve Blokzincir Teknolojisindeki Rolü

Tendermint, ağ ve konsensüs katmanlarını uygulama mantığından ayıran modüler bir mimari sunar. Bu tasarım sayesinde geliştiriciler, işlem doğrulama veya blok yayımı gibi temel bileşenleri yeniden geliştirmeden kendi özel blokzincir özelliklerini inşa etmeye odaklanabilirler. Çekirdeğinde ise Tendermint, kötü niyetli aktörlerle başa çıkabilen yüksek performanslı verimli bir sistem oluşturan Byzantine Fault Tolerant (BFT) konsensüs mekanizması ile Proof of Stake (PoS) kombinasyonunu kullanır.

Tendermint Tarafından Kullanılan Konsensüs Algoritması: Derinlemesine Bir Bakış

Tendermint tarafından kullanılan temel konsensüs protokolü Tendermint Core'un BFT konsensüs algoritması olarak bilinir. Bu hibrit yaklaşım, validator seçiminde PoS’yi kullanırken; bazı validator’ların hatalı veya kötü niyetli olması durumunda bile uzlaşmaya ulaşmak için BFT’yi devreye sokar.

Nasıl Çalışır?

Basitçe söylemek gerekirse; yeni blokları önerip doğrulayan katılımcılar—validator’lar—ağırlıklarına göre seçilirler. Validator’lar çeşitli aşamalardan oluşan döngülerde: ön-oylama (pre-vote) ve ön-uzlaşma (pre-commit), yeni blokların geçerliliği konusunda oy kullanırlar. Uzlaşmaya ulaşmak için:

  • Validator’ların üçte ikisinden (f) fazlası önerilen bloğa onay vermelidir.
  • Birden fazla oy verme turu içeren süreçte yeterli uzlaşı sağlanana kadar devam eder.
  • Kötü niyetli faaliyetler veya arızalar nedeniyle anlaşmazlık çıkarsa bile protokol en fazla üçte biri oranında hatalı düğüm kabul edilebilir ve yine de güvenlik bozulmaz.

Bu mekanizma sayesinde bazı düğümler dürüst olmayan davranışlarda bulunsa veya beklenmedik şekilde çevrim dışı kalsa bile dürüst katılımcılar ağı bütünlüğünü koruyabilir.

Byzantine Fault Tolerance Neden Önemlidir?

Byzantine Fault Tolerance (BFT), dağıtık sistemlerde en zorlu sorunlardan biri olan "Byzantine" yani kötü niyetli ya da hatalı davranan katılımcılara rağmen güvenilir uzlaşıyı sağlamayı amaçlayan çözümdür.

Geleneksel sistemlerde örneğin Proof of Work (PoW), mutabakat sağlamak büyük enerji tüketimi gerektirirken; Tendermint gibi BFT algoritmaları minimum güvensizlik varsayımlarıyla çalışır ancak yine de hızlı kesinlik sağlar—bir kez uzlaşıldığında geri alınamaz hale gelir—bu da onları kurumsal seviyedeki uygulamalar için uygun kılar.

PoS ile BFT Kullanımının Sağladığı Avantajlar

Proof of Stake ile Byzantine Fault Tolerance’nin birleşimi birkaç önemli avantaj getirir:

  • Enerji Verimliliği: Bitcoin gibi PoW tabanlı sistemlerin yüksek enerji tüketimine kıyasla PoS tabanlı algoritmalar önemli ölçüde daha az güç harcar.

  • Güvenlik: BFT yapısı 3’e kadar kötü niyetli katılımda dahi direnci sağlar.

  • Ölçeklenebilirlik: Modüler tasarım diğer teknolojilerle entegrasyonu kolaylaştırır; böylece Tendermint tabanlı ağlar geleneksel PoW zincirlerine göre daha iyi ölçeklenebilir hale gelir.

  • Hızlı Sonuçlandırma: Tendermind protokolünde onaylanan işlemler anında kesinleşir; zaman içinde tekrar tekrar onay beklemeye gerek kalmaz.

Bu özellikler özellikle gizlilik odaklı özel blockchain'ler veya konsorsiyum ağları gibi yüksek performans garantisinin kritik olduğu kurumsal çözümler için tendemirt’i cazip kılar.

Pratik Uygulamalar & Ekosistem Üzerindeki Etkisi

Tendermint’in sağlam konsensüs mekanizması, Cosmos ekosistemi içindeki çeşitli projelerde benimsenmiştir—bağımsız blockchain'lerin birlikte çalışabilirliği hedefiyle kurulmuş bu ağda kullanılmaktadır. Terra gibi projeler de altyapısına tendemirt teknolojisini entegre ederek güvenli çapraz zincir iletişimi ile verimli işlem işleme imkanını yakalamıştır.

Ayrıca birçok DeFi platformu da bu teknolojiyi tercih etmektedir çünkü yüksek işlem hacmini karşılayıp aynı zamanda kullanıcı güvenini sağlayacak merkeziyetsizlik standartlarını korur. Gelişen küresel benimseme ile birlikte—from yeni protokoller geliştiren girişimler seviyesinden büyük finans kurumlarına kadar—bu tür ağların nasıl güvenle anlaşma sağladığını anlamanın önemi artmaktadır.

Tendemirt’in Konsensüs Yaklaşımındaki Zorluklar & Riskler

Tendemirt’in PoS + BFT temelli yapısının sunduğu pek çok avantajın yanı sıra bazı doğrudan riskleri de mevcuttur:

  1. Merkeziyet Riski: Eğer büyük pay sahipleri validator setini domine ederse—önemli miktarda token tutarlarsa—karar alma süreçlerinde orantısız etki sahibi olabilirler.

  2. Güvenlik Endişeleri: Doğru uygulanıp sürekli güncellenmiş olsa da hiçbir sistem sonsuza dek savunmasız değildir; zamanla ortaya çıkabilecek açıklar dikkatle izlenmelidir.

  3. Ağın Katılım Sorunları: Validator’ların aktif katılımını sağlamak kritik olup düşük iştirak durumu merkezileşmeyi güçlendirebilir ya da hata tolerans sınırlarını tehlikeye atabilir.

Araştırmalar bu riskleri azaltmak adına teşvik mekanizmaları ve adil validator dağıtımı üzerine yoğunlaşmaktadır.

Bu Durum Blockchain Geliştirmesini Nasıl Etkiliyor?

Tendemirt'in benzersiz özelliğinin anlaşılması, geliştiricilerin proje hedeflerine uygun çerçeveleri seçmesine yardımcı olur; örneğin ölçeklenebilirlikle merkeziyetsizlik arasındaki denge ya da enerji verimliliği ihtiyaçları.. Kombinasyonu özellikle izin verilen ağlarda hızlı sonuçlandırmayı mümkün kıldığından dolayı oldukça etkili çözüm sunar.

Son Düşünceler: Neden Tendermine’nin Konsensüs Algoritmasını Tercih Etmeliyiz?

Farklı blockchain protokolleri arasındaki seçim büyük ölçüde temel mekanizmaların anlaşılmasına bağlıdır ki bunlardan biri de tendemirt'in kullanım alanına özgü güçlü yönleridir.. Proof-of-Stake ile Byzantine Fault Tolerance ilkelerini harmanlayan hibrit model,

geliştiricilere erişim sağlarenerji açısından verimli,güvenli,ve ölçeklenebilir bir altyapıgelecek nesil merkeziyetsiz uygulamaları inşa etmek için.. Ekosistemlerin evrildiği şu dönemde—increasingly odak noktası olan birlikte çalışabilirlik bağlamında—the tendemirts benzeri sağlam konsensuslara sahip yapıların rolü giderek daha belirleyici hale gelecektir.

19
0
0
0
Background
Avatar

JCUSER-WVMdslBw

2025-05-14 11:02

Tendermint hangi uzlaşma algoritmasını kullanır?

Tendermint Hangi Konsensüs Algoritmasını Kullanıyor?

Tendermint, blokzincir uygulamalarının geliştirilmesini kolaylaştırmak amacıyla tasarlanmış önde gelen açık kaynaklı bir çerçevedir. Gücünün temelinde, merkeziyetsiz bir ağdaki tüm düğümlerin blokzincirin mevcut durumu üzerinde anlaşmasını sağlayan konsensüs algoritması yatmaktadır. Bu algoritmanın anlaşılması, Tendermint’in güvenlik, verimlilik ve ölçeklenebilirliği nasıl koruduğunu kavramak isteyen geliştiriciler, yatırımcılar ve meraklılar için çok önemlidir.

Tendermint'in Genel Bakışı ve Blokzincir Teknolojisindeki Rolü

Tendermint, ağ ve konsensüs katmanlarını uygulama mantığından ayıran modüler bir mimari sunar. Bu tasarım sayesinde geliştiriciler, işlem doğrulama veya blok yayımı gibi temel bileşenleri yeniden geliştirmeden kendi özel blokzincir özelliklerini inşa etmeye odaklanabilirler. Çekirdeğinde ise Tendermint, kötü niyetli aktörlerle başa çıkabilen yüksek performanslı verimli bir sistem oluşturan Byzantine Fault Tolerant (BFT) konsensüs mekanizması ile Proof of Stake (PoS) kombinasyonunu kullanır.

Tendermint Tarafından Kullanılan Konsensüs Algoritması: Derinlemesine Bir Bakış

Tendermint tarafından kullanılan temel konsensüs protokolü Tendermint Core'un BFT konsensüs algoritması olarak bilinir. Bu hibrit yaklaşım, validator seçiminde PoS’yi kullanırken; bazı validator’ların hatalı veya kötü niyetli olması durumunda bile uzlaşmaya ulaşmak için BFT’yi devreye sokar.

Nasıl Çalışır?

Basitçe söylemek gerekirse; yeni blokları önerip doğrulayan katılımcılar—validator’lar—ağırlıklarına göre seçilirler. Validator’lar çeşitli aşamalardan oluşan döngülerde: ön-oylama (pre-vote) ve ön-uzlaşma (pre-commit), yeni blokların geçerliliği konusunda oy kullanırlar. Uzlaşmaya ulaşmak için:

  • Validator’ların üçte ikisinden (f) fazlası önerilen bloğa onay vermelidir.
  • Birden fazla oy verme turu içeren süreçte yeterli uzlaşı sağlanana kadar devam eder.
  • Kötü niyetli faaliyetler veya arızalar nedeniyle anlaşmazlık çıkarsa bile protokol en fazla üçte biri oranında hatalı düğüm kabul edilebilir ve yine de güvenlik bozulmaz.

Bu mekanizma sayesinde bazı düğümler dürüst olmayan davranışlarda bulunsa veya beklenmedik şekilde çevrim dışı kalsa bile dürüst katılımcılar ağı bütünlüğünü koruyabilir.

Byzantine Fault Tolerance Neden Önemlidir?

Byzantine Fault Tolerance (BFT), dağıtık sistemlerde en zorlu sorunlardan biri olan "Byzantine" yani kötü niyetli ya da hatalı davranan katılımcılara rağmen güvenilir uzlaşıyı sağlamayı amaçlayan çözümdür.

Geleneksel sistemlerde örneğin Proof of Work (PoW), mutabakat sağlamak büyük enerji tüketimi gerektirirken; Tendermint gibi BFT algoritmaları minimum güvensizlik varsayımlarıyla çalışır ancak yine de hızlı kesinlik sağlar—bir kez uzlaşıldığında geri alınamaz hale gelir—bu da onları kurumsal seviyedeki uygulamalar için uygun kılar.

PoS ile BFT Kullanımının Sağladığı Avantajlar

Proof of Stake ile Byzantine Fault Tolerance’nin birleşimi birkaç önemli avantaj getirir:

  • Enerji Verimliliği: Bitcoin gibi PoW tabanlı sistemlerin yüksek enerji tüketimine kıyasla PoS tabanlı algoritmalar önemli ölçüde daha az güç harcar.

  • Güvenlik: BFT yapısı 3’e kadar kötü niyetli katılımda dahi direnci sağlar.

  • Ölçeklenebilirlik: Modüler tasarım diğer teknolojilerle entegrasyonu kolaylaştırır; böylece Tendermint tabanlı ağlar geleneksel PoW zincirlerine göre daha iyi ölçeklenebilir hale gelir.

  • Hızlı Sonuçlandırma: Tendermind protokolünde onaylanan işlemler anında kesinleşir; zaman içinde tekrar tekrar onay beklemeye gerek kalmaz.

Bu özellikler özellikle gizlilik odaklı özel blockchain'ler veya konsorsiyum ağları gibi yüksek performans garantisinin kritik olduğu kurumsal çözümler için tendemirt’i cazip kılar.

Pratik Uygulamalar & Ekosistem Üzerindeki Etkisi

Tendermint’in sağlam konsensüs mekanizması, Cosmos ekosistemi içindeki çeşitli projelerde benimsenmiştir—bağımsız blockchain'lerin birlikte çalışabilirliği hedefiyle kurulmuş bu ağda kullanılmaktadır. Terra gibi projeler de altyapısına tendemirt teknolojisini entegre ederek güvenli çapraz zincir iletişimi ile verimli işlem işleme imkanını yakalamıştır.

Ayrıca birçok DeFi platformu da bu teknolojiyi tercih etmektedir çünkü yüksek işlem hacmini karşılayıp aynı zamanda kullanıcı güvenini sağlayacak merkeziyetsizlik standartlarını korur. Gelişen küresel benimseme ile birlikte—from yeni protokoller geliştiren girişimler seviyesinden büyük finans kurumlarına kadar—bu tür ağların nasıl güvenle anlaşma sağladığını anlamanın önemi artmaktadır.

Tendemirt’in Konsensüs Yaklaşımındaki Zorluklar & Riskler

Tendemirt’in PoS + BFT temelli yapısının sunduğu pek çok avantajın yanı sıra bazı doğrudan riskleri de mevcuttur:

  1. Merkeziyet Riski: Eğer büyük pay sahipleri validator setini domine ederse—önemli miktarda token tutarlarsa—karar alma süreçlerinde orantısız etki sahibi olabilirler.

  2. Güvenlik Endişeleri: Doğru uygulanıp sürekli güncellenmiş olsa da hiçbir sistem sonsuza dek savunmasız değildir; zamanla ortaya çıkabilecek açıklar dikkatle izlenmelidir.

  3. Ağın Katılım Sorunları: Validator’ların aktif katılımını sağlamak kritik olup düşük iştirak durumu merkezileşmeyi güçlendirebilir ya da hata tolerans sınırlarını tehlikeye atabilir.

Araştırmalar bu riskleri azaltmak adına teşvik mekanizmaları ve adil validator dağıtımı üzerine yoğunlaşmaktadır.

Bu Durum Blockchain Geliştirmesini Nasıl Etkiliyor?

Tendemirt'in benzersiz özelliğinin anlaşılması, geliştiricilerin proje hedeflerine uygun çerçeveleri seçmesine yardımcı olur; örneğin ölçeklenebilirlikle merkeziyetsizlik arasındaki denge ya da enerji verimliliği ihtiyaçları.. Kombinasyonu özellikle izin verilen ağlarda hızlı sonuçlandırmayı mümkün kıldığından dolayı oldukça etkili çözüm sunar.

Son Düşünceler: Neden Tendermine’nin Konsensüs Algoritmasını Tercih Etmeliyiz?

Farklı blockchain protokolleri arasındaki seçim büyük ölçüde temel mekanizmaların anlaşılmasına bağlıdır ki bunlardan biri de tendemirt'in kullanım alanına özgü güçlü yönleridir.. Proof-of-Stake ile Byzantine Fault Tolerance ilkelerini harmanlayan hibrit model,

geliştiricilere erişim sağlarenerji açısından verimli,güvenli,ve ölçeklenebilir bir altyapıgelecek nesil merkeziyetsiz uygulamaları inşa etmek için.. Ekosistemlerin evrildiği şu dönemde—increasingly odak noktası olan birlikte çalışabilirlik bağlamında—the tendemirts benzeri sağlam konsensuslara sahip yapıların rolü giderek daha belirleyici hale gelecektir.

JuCoin Square

Sorumluluk Reddi:Üçüncü taraf içeriği içerir. Finansal tavsiye değildir.
Hüküm ve Koşullar'a bakın.